Site Infrastructure & Power Management System ( SIMS ) is a combination of various Functional Blocks that facilitates management of Unmanned Telecom Sites. This is a complete standalone site manager which makes maximum Utilization of Grid Power. This can be ordered with various combinations to suit every site or need. Built in Class-B & C Lightning and Surge protection, RFI/EMI/EMC/EFT filters. SIMS meets international standards i.e. CE, UL etc.

Technical Specifications
Functional Blocks
- . Phase Selector
- . Class-B & Class-C Lightning & Surge Protection
- . Static Line Conditioner & Isolation Transformer
- . Automatic Transfer Switch (ATS) & Generator Management
- . Air-conditioner controller
- . Alarm Management & Event Logging
- . AC Distribution
- . Site Status Communications & Management Functions
Phase Selector
- . Selects the best available phase(s)
- . Three Phase Delta Input -P-P Output
- . Three Phase Star Input -P-N Output
- . HVD / LVD / Overload protection
- . Hysteresis and time delay to prevent hunting Stabilizers for contactor drive
Lightning & Surge Protection
- . Class B & Class C protection
Static Line Conditioner Unit (LCU)
- . SCR based -robust performance
- . High correction speed (10 m sec) with no moving parts
- . Isolation Transformer included
- . Wide Input Range (170V -480V)
- . 1 or 2 LCU's per system
- . Ratings 5 / 7.5 / 12.5 /15 kVA
